Clearbit runs on people as much as on accounts: every contact, deal, and account has an owner, and those owners are employees whose roles, teams, and status are held in Paylocity. Paylocity is the system of record for the workforce, from new hires to promotions to departures, and often for the candidates the business is still deciding on. When the two systems are connected only by re-keying or an overnight export, they drift apart, and the CRM ends up assigning accounts to people who have left, holding territories that no longer match the org chart, and waiting days to give a new rep access.
When Paylocity records a new hire, a matching user or owner is created in Clearbit, so a new rep can start working accounts without waiting on a manual setup ticket.
When a person changes team, manager, or region in Paylocity, their accounts and territory assignments in Clearbit update to match, so pipeline stays with the right owner.
When Paylocity marks a worker as departed, the matching user in Clearbit is flagged or deactivated, so former employees do not keep CRM access after their last day.

Change detection on Clearbit: On-demand lookups; asynchronous enrichment results can be delivered via webhook callbacks. On Paylocity: Webhooks — Paylocity POSTs Employee New Hire, Employee Change, Termination, Payroll Processed, and Time Off Approval events to a callback URL; payloads carry only companyId and employeeId, so the receiver calls the relevant API to fetch changed values. Scheduled polling is used for objects without webhooks. Each detected change propagates to the other side in milliseconds, with field-level conflict resolution and an inspectable event log.
